Output 54c20699a132153226dafd541e1a02b6b929d39455edd3931c69e0f4a14fbed5:5

value
5000000
script pubkey
OP_0 OP_PUSHBYTES_20 d1d2fcb8c7ac387b31e13c8e4436b75b6025b9c1
address
bc1q68f0ewx84su8kv0p8j8ygd4htdsztwwp9kp8a6
transaction
54c20699a132153226dafd541e1a02b6b929d39455edd3931c69e0f4a14fbed5
spent
true